Kia is crushing it in America, and sidestepping tariffs — for now

Last updated: March 15, 2025 8:01 am
Share
Kia is crushing it in America, and sidestepping tariffs — for now
SHARE

Kia, the South Korean automaker, is making waves in the automotive industry with its impressive sales performance in the American market. Kia America, a subsidiary of the Hyundai Motor Group, recently announced another record-breaking sales month in February, driven by a diverse range of vehicles including the popular Telluride SUV and the EV6 crossover.

Steven Center, the COO & EVP of Kia Americas, emphasized the company’s commitment to sustainable mobility, which includes a mix of EVs, hybrids, and plug-in hybrids. Despite the industry trend towards SUVs, Kia has also continued to invest in sedans, introducing models like the midsize K4 and the larger K5, which is manufactured in North America.

One of Kia’s key strategies for growth is localizing production in the US, with plans to produce EVs in Georgia. Center highlighted Kia’s long-standing presence in the US market, with significant investments in American manufacturing and the supply chain.

While the prospect of auto tariffs looms large, particularly in light of Ford CEO Jim Farley’s concerns about unfair competition, Kia remains confident in its ability to navigate any potential challenges. Center expressed confidence in Kia’s business plan and its strong US footprint, which positions the company well to adapt to changing trade dynamics.

Looking ahead, Kia is focused on expanding its EV production capabilities at its joint plant with Hyundai in Georgia. Center reiterated Kia’s commitment to building cars locally and emphasized the company’s dedication to doing what is best for Kia and its customers.

Kia, the South Korean automaker, has been making significant investments in its domestic production facilities in the US. With a whopping $20.5 billion spent on these facilities, the company boasts of employing over 570,000 workers in the country. This commitment to domestic production has been a key focus for Kia, as evidenced by their recent unveiling of new vehicles at the “Kia Day” event in Portugal.

One of the standout vehicles showcased at the event was the EV4, a sporty electric sedan available in hatchback form as well. Kia’s President, Center, believes that cars like the EV4 will not cannibalize sales of other similar vehicles in their lineup, such as the gas-powered K4 or the larger EV6 midsize crossover. Instead, he sees these new electric models as bringing in “net incremental volume,” meaning they will attract additional customers to the brand rather than simply shifting sales from one model to another.

While some industry experts remain skeptical about the potential cannibalization of sales, Center is confident in Kia’s strategy of offering a wide product portfolio in the US market. He believes that having a diverse range of powertrains will ultimately expand sales and attract new customers to the brand.

Despite concerns about economic jitters and the possibility of a slowdown in the US economy in the future, Center and Kia remain optimistic about growth. Center expressed confidence in the market’s potential, stating that as long as there aren’t any major shocks to the system, they are planning for another record year in sales.
